Energy savings of solar water heater
On average, if you install a solar water heater, your water heating bills should drop 50%–80%. Also, because the sun is free, you're protected from future fuel shortages and price hikes. If you're building a new home or refinancing, the economics are even more attractive. [pdf][FAQS about Energy savings of solar water heater]

Solar water heater panel repair
The national average cost for repairing solar water heaters is between $150 and $750, with most homeowners paying about $400 for replacing a damaged or broken coil. This project’s low cost is $50 for repairing a leaky pressure valve. [pdf][FAQS about Solar water heater panel repair]

Pump controller for solar water system
A solar pump controller will convert any excess voltage of the solar array to more output current, allowing the pump to operate during ‘stall' periods. If the pump was hooked directly to the panel it would not operate during these times. [pdf][FAQS about Pump controller for solar water system]

Nabard scheme for solar photovoltaic water pumping system mnre
Under the Scheme, central government subsidy upto 30% or 50% of the total cost is given for the installation of standalone solar pumps and also for the solarization of existing grid-connected agricultural pumps. [pdf][FAQS about Nabard scheme for solar photovoltaic water pumping system mnre]

Solar water heater vs photovoltaic
While both technologies use sunlight to create energy, they achieve very different results: solar photovoltaic panels turn sunlight into electricity, while a solar water heating system uses the heat from sunlight to heat your property’s water supply. Most utility-scale fixed-tilt solar photovoltaic systems
Nearly 40%, or 10.4 gigawatts (GW), of utility-scale solar photovoltaic (PV) systems operating in the United States at the end of 2017 were fixed-tilt PV systems rather than tracking systems. Of the utility-scale fixed-tilt solar PV systems, 76% of the capacity was installed at a fixed angle between 20 degrees and 30 degrees from the horizon. Solar fiber optic lighting systems
Solar fiber optic lighting setups are an alternative to traditional indoor lights using fiber optic technology. Fiber optic cables are designed to carry light from point to point by internally reflecting it along their length. Solar fiber optic setups allow you to capture sunlight, transmit it inside, and emit it in your home or business. [pdf][FAQS about Solar fiber optic lighting systems]

Azerbaijan wind and solar hybrid systems
Azerbaijan’s renewable energy sources are hydropower, wind, solar, and biomass power plants. Together, these generated 1.48 billion kilowatt-hours (kWh) of energy in 2018, comprising almost 9% of the total production of 17.2 billion kWh. Solar Power Plants of 20 MW and over include: • Garadagh Solar Power Plant – 230 MW [pdf][FAQS about Azerbaijan wind and solar hybrid systems]

Integrated solar roofing systems
An integrated solar roof is designed to seamlessly blend solar panels with roofing materials, resulting in a roofing system that generates clean energy while protecting your home from the elements. The process involves integrating solar cells directly into the roofing material1. Unlike traditional solar panel systems that use separate racks, integrated solar roofing provides better roof protection and curb appeal2. [pdf][FAQS about Integrated solar roofing systems]

Understanding solar power systems Pakistan
Solar power in Pakistan became part of the energy mix in 2013, following government policies aimed at supporting development. Benefiting from nine and a half hours of sunlight daily, the country now has seven solar projects that contribute 530 MW to the national grid. Dc off grid solar power systems
The four main components of an off-grid solar systemSolar Panel: A solar panel converts sunlight into Direct Current (DC) electricity. . Battery: A battery takes the electrical power from the solar panel and stores it.Solar Charge Controller: In-between the panel and the battery is the charge controller. . Power Inverter: A power inverter converts the stored DC power to Alternating Current (AC) power for use in standard appliances. [pdf][FAQS about Dc off grid solar power systems]
